Understanding Game Setup and Components
To fully appreciate this captivating experience, familiarizing oneself with the essential elements is crucial. The structure consists of a vertical board, typically featuring a series of pegs and slots at the bottom, where participants aim to direct their tokens.
Start by examining the board layout, which consists of arranged pegs that cause tokens to bounce unpredictably, creating a thrilling element of chance. Each slot at the bottom holds a predetermined point value, contributing to overall scoring.
Tokens are made from durable materials, often resembling small discs, which ensures smooth navigation. Choosing the right type of token can influence performance; heavier options may descend more quickly, while lighter ones can stay in play longer.
Additionally, a release mechanism is integrated at the top of the board, allowing for a simple yet effective launching of the tokens. Familiarize yourself with this mechanism as it can impact launching precision.
It is also important to understand scoring methods associated with each slot. Some slots offer multipliers or special bonuses, encouraging strategic placement. Players should analyze patterns and position their tokens to optimize scoring opportunities.
